# Модуль импорта/экспорта файлов mif/mid ## [4.8.17] - 20.02.2025 Иправлена ошибка "is not valid date". ## [4.8.16] - 28.01.2025 Добавлена возможность импорта mif файлов последних версий MapInfo. Добавлена поддержка кодировки UTF-16 при импорте. Добавлена возможность импорта значений поля типа LargeInt (Большое целое число). Добавлена возможность импорта значений поля типа DateTime (Дата и время). Добавлена возможность импорта значений поля типа Time (Время). ## [4.8.15] - 13.11.2024 Исправлена ошибка с кодировкой UTF-8 при импорте. ## [4.8.14.680] - 25.09.2023 Исправлены ошибки с семантикой, возникающие при импорте нескольких файлов. ## [4.7.12.675] - 15.09.2023 Исправлена ошибка импорта файлов с повторяющимися двойными кавычками. Исправлена ошибка импорта файлов. Импортировались пустые значения полей. ## [4.7.11.670] - 04.09.2023 Исправлена ошибка "could not convert variant of type (string) into type (*)", возникающая при импорте файлов, содержащих одинаковые названия полей. ## [4.7.10.660] - 18.08.2023 Исправлена ошибка "could not convert variant of type (string) into type (*)", возникающая при импорте нескольких файлов. Исправлен пользовательский интерфейс окна импорта. Разделена вкладка "Информация и параметры импорта" на две отдельные вкладки. Добавлен параметр "Максимальное количество импортируемых семантических полей файла". Эта настройка импорта позволяет ограничивать чтение множества полей у файла. СПараметр создан для оптимизации скорости импорта для импорта множества файлов с большим количеством семантических полей. ## [4.7.9.655] - 30.06.2023 Исправлен алгоритм вычисления границ (CoordSys Bounds) объектов в файле при экспорте. Теперь задаются координаты границы территории БД. Если объекты файла выходят за границы территории, то задаются координаты границы территории, расширенной до границы всех объектов. ## [4.7.8.653] - 08.06.2023 Исправлена ошибка "Неизвестное свойство объекта Brush". ## [4.7.7.651] - 11.04.2023 Исправлена ошибка пустых полей при импорте. ## [4.7.7.650] - 24.03.2023 Исправлена ошибка пустых полей при импорте. ## [4.7.6.647] - 28.02.2023 Исправлена ошибка Assertion failure ArrayUtils line 845. Добавлена возможность импорта mif файла при отсутствующем mid файле. Добавлен вывод ошибок в журнале красным цветом. ## [4.7.5.637] - 22.02.2023 Исправлена ошибка List index out of bounds (1). ## [4.7.5.636] - 20.02.2023 Добавлен вывод информации об импортируемом файле в окне информации об ошибке. ## [4.7.5.635] - 06.02.2023 Исправлена ошибка. Поля семантики не заполнялись у импортируемого объекта, если различались названия полей в источнике и таблице ИнГео. ## [4.7.4.630] - 24.01.2023 Исправлена ошибка. В некоторый случаях не работало обновление объектов при указании ключевого поля. ## [4.7.3.623] - 29.12.2022 Исправлено поведение при возникновении ошибки "В полигоне только одна точка". Ошибка фиксируется и продолжается импорт. ## [4.7.3.614] - 13.10.2022 Исправлена ошибка представления системы координат в файле mif при экспорте. ## [4.7.3.611] - 12.10.2022 Исправлена ошибка чтения многострочных данных. Исправлена ошибка при импорте "Could not convert variant of type (OleStr) into type (Double)". Исправлена ошибка пользовательского интерфейса при импорте. Не показывались галочки у стилей. ## [4.7.2.598] - 11.05.2022 Добавлено отображение версии модуля в заголовке главного окна модуля. ## [4.7.1.590] - 15.03.2022 Исправлен алгоритм поиска объектов по ключу. Исправлена форма подтверждения сценария пользователем. Исправлен пользовательский интерфейс формы общей настройки импорта. Косметические исправления. ## [4.7.0.584] - 10.03.2022 Исправлен пользовательский интерфейс. Косметические исправления. ## [4.7.0.582] - 07.03.2022 Добавлена актуализация импортируемых объектов. ## [4.6.0.580] - 22.02.2022 Добавлена оптимизация по скорости импорта множества файлов. ## [4.5.9.568] - 04.02.2022 Исправлена ошибка AccessViolation, возникающая на форме настройки системы координат. ## [4.5.9.567] - 17.11.2021 Исправлена ошибка чтения mid файла ## [4.5.9.561] - 19.10.2021 Добавлена возможность добавлять файлы, указав каталог. Исправлены лаги при добавлении файлов в исходный список. Исправлена версионность модуля ## [4.5.9.514] - 30.11.2020 Исправлена ошибка Access Violation ## [4.5.9.511] - 26.11.2020 Исправление ошибок с наименование системных параметров объектов (периметр, площадь, идентификатор) ## [4.5.9.545] - 11.09.2020 Добавлена возможность экспортировать системные данные объекта, такие как площадь и периметр объекта. Для этого необходимо отметить галочкой поле "Экспортировать площадь и периметр". Галочка по умолчанию установлена. Изменено название поля "ID" на "ИнГео_Идентификатор_объекта" (InGeo_ID). Название "ИнГео_Идентификатор_объекта" или "InGeo_ID" зависит от параметра настройки экспорта "Использовать заголовки полей". ## [4.5.9.519] - 12.08.2020 Исправлена ошибка "Не найден путь". Ошибка возникала в случае, если название карты или слоя имели в конце пробелы. ## [4.5.8.509] - 10.08.2020 Добавлена поддержка новых типов объектов (MULTIPOINT) Исправлено поведение импорта. Теперь при отсутствии в файле mif описания точечного символа, в Ингео создается символьный метод отображения в виде окружности для масштаба 1:50 ## [4.5.8.494] - 02.07.2020 Добавлена поддержка импорта некорректных форматов, полученных от Росреестра. Некорректность формата связана с нечетным количеством кавычек в строковом поле, а также одинарных обрамляющих кавычек (должны быть дублирующиеся). ## [4.5.7.479] - 29.04.2020 Исправлена ошибка сохранения настроек модуля при импорте Исправлена ошибка инициализации трансформации при экспорте и импорте. ## [4.5.7.473] - 27.04.2020 Добавлена поддержка преобразования в системы координат, разделенных на зоны ## [4.5.6.487] - 02.04.2020 Добавлена возможность экспортировать каждый объект в отдельный файл MIFMID ## [4.4.5.460] - 20.03.2020 Исправлена ошибка "Неправильный формат строки. Не найдены закрывающие кавычки". Ошибка возникала в определенных файлах, полученных из Росреестра. ## [4.4.5.407] Добавлена поддержка команды Collection ## [4.4.5.396] Исправлена ошибка "Неизвестный тип DateTime" Исправлена ошибка "Индекс массива 0 выходит за пределы [0, -1]", возникающая при импорте объектов без пространственных данных. Теперь такие объекты игнорируются и в журнал импорта добавляется запись о данной проблеме. ## [4.4.5.391] Исправлено поведение при возникновении ошибки "В полигоне только одна точка". Импорт теперь продолжается и в журнал импорта добавляется запись о данной проблеме. ## [4.4.5.373] Исправлена ошибка расчета общей территории всех экспортируемых объектов ## [4.4.5.368] Добавлено при экспорте запоминание последних примененных настроек каталога и трансформации.